问题标签 [rightbarbuttonitem]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票
2 回答
5426 浏览

swift - 条形按钮项目不起作用

我已经阅读了这里的其他帖子并尝试了他们所说的所有内容,但仍然不适合我,我真的需要添加一个右栏按钮项目,我已经尝试过代码(对我不起作用),我发现可能对我有帮助的东西,但是,我不知道它在 xCode 界面中的位置,这是我找到的图像:图片 有人可以告诉我如何使这项工作吗?

这是左侧的故事板(颜色更改)和右侧的模拟器,正如您在故事板中看到的那样,它显示了我的 barButtonItem,但是当我运行它时它没有显示。我的项目

0 投票
1 回答
169 浏览

ios - 以编程方式添加导航按钮的 performSegue

我正在尝试以编程方式自定义导航栏按钮项...我只是在这里遇到了一些问题,我相信这些问题很容易解决。我现在想让它成为默认的添加按钮,但将来也会想让栏按钮项成为我创建的自定义图标。所以我想我想知道如何以编程方式将导航栏按钮更改为默认样式和自定义图标...谢谢!

0 投票
3 回答
66 浏览

ios - RightBarButtonItem 仅显示为非活动状态

尝试将刷新按钮显示为 rightBarButtonItem 时,我遇到了一个奇怪的问题。

简而言之,我已经实现了它,但是在运行应用程序时什么都看不到。但是,当我单击情节提要时Debug --> View Debugging --> Capture View Hierarchy。我可以看到一个似乎不活动且隐藏的刷新按钮。我不知道为什么。

在此处输入图像描述

viewcontrol 实际上是通过自定义的 pageviewcontroller 推入的。

请问我错过了什么?

0 投票
1 回答
400 浏览

ios - 如何将多个栏按钮添加到导航栏

最初我创建了一个名为“mainView”的动态视图。在那之后,我添加了导航栏。之后,我想向导航栏添加 2 个右栏按钮。如果我这样编码,它会显示带有导航栏的视图。但它没有显示右栏按钮。

1.是否可以在没有导航控制器的情况下添加导航栏?

2.为什么右栏按钮不显示?

0 投票
2 回答
148 浏览

ios - 可以将故事板中的导航右栏按钮与编码的按钮结合起来吗?

嗨,我在情节提要中创建了一个正确的导航栏按钮项。我现在想在 Apple 的日历应用程序中添加第二个右键。纯代码版本将是:

但是,我已经在情节提要中创建了一个按钮,其中包含各种出口和转场,理想情况下希望在添加第二个时保留它。我的理解是您现在可以在 Xcode7 的故事板中创建两个按钮,但我仍在 Xcode 6 中,所以我正在考虑某种混合故事板代码解决方案。

这在 Xcode 6 中可能吗?

0 投票
1 回答
46 浏览

ios - UIKeyboardWillShowNotification 中的条形按钮项目动画

我无法弄清楚出了什么问题。我在导航栏中有 2 个右键,当键盘打开时我想要 A 和 B 按钮,当键盘关闭时,A 和 C,或者可能只是 C。我这样做了。我使用 UIKeyboardWillShowNotification 来检查键盘何时打开或关闭。

它工作正常。问题是当我调用“KeyboardWillShow”和“KeyboardWillHide”方法时,正确的按钮会飞进来。见这里:GIF

我试过这个,它工作正常,但只有在关闭键盘时。

0 投票
2 回答
29 浏览

ios - 为什么按钮宽度在 UINavigationbar 中有冲突?

我在 UINavigation Bar Button Item 中有一个按钮在此处输入图像描述

这是我的期望,但真正发生的是在此处输入图像描述按钮宽度越来越低,如何摆脱这个恒定的宽度?任何想法的朋友。

0 投票
1 回答
119 浏览

swift - 通过 RightBarButtonItem 移动到另一个 Viewcontroller

我有以下情况:

我在我的viewDidLoad:

我的问题是,我怎样才能通过使用segue“显示(例如推送)”以编程方式点击此按钮移动到另一个Viewcontroller。

我的开头是这样的:

但我不知道更多,因为我是 Swift 的初学者。

任何帮助将非常感激!

更新:

因此,这是出现错误的整个区域:

错误出现在此行:

这条线在这里:

0 投票
9 回答
9240 浏览

ios - 如何使用 swift 在 QLPreviewController 中隐藏共享按钮?

我正在使用下面的代码来使用 QLPreviewcontroller 在我的应用程序中显示一些文档,

我不希望 QLPreviewcontroller 右上角的共享按钮。我试过设置rightBarButtonItem为零,但它不起作用。

我该如何隐藏它?

0 投票
2 回答
62 浏览

ios - 导航栏上的 RightBar 按钮没有像看起来一样点击

我想显示图像和标题,RightBar Button所以我编写了如下代码:

此代码显示标题和图像NavigationBar,当我单击它时,单击的喜欢仅出现在图像上,而不出现在文本上。